MAR Park hits another bump in the road.

From Carolyn Gerding, posted on the Mar Park froum at 2:30pm January 5th 2012.

Montgomery County’s Judge Keith Sutherland has denied the Motions to Dismiss of Mid America Raceway Park and the Montgomery County Commission. No explanation or reasoning was given. He also entered an Order Granting Leave to File Amended Petition which allowed the Plaintiffs to file a Verified Amended Petition for Review of Writ of Certiorari. This purportedly corrects the items MARP and the County Commission claimed were incorrect in their Motions to Dismiss.
The documents are file-stamped December 28, but they did not reach the Montgomery County Circuit Clerk’s office or get entered into CaseNet until Thurs., Jan. 5 when Judge Sutherland appeared for Law Day. Sutherland is the Presiding Judge over the 12th Circuit which consists of Montgomery, Warren, and Audrain Counties.
It is now up to the attorneys to request a trial date, unless more motions are filed.
Ronnie Moss, lead developer of Mid America Raceway Park, said that he and his partners are not letting this stop them. The Conditional Use Permit which was issued by the County Commission is still in effect and they can legally proceed if they want to. Moss said , “MAR Park is going to continue on. This is just another bump in the road, but if the Good Lord is willing, MAR will prevail. We have a lot of supporters and Montgomery County wants the drag strip as much as MAR wants to call Montgomery County and the City of New Florence our new home. MAR Park will have a big positive economic impact not only for Montgomery County, but also for Warren County and other surrounding counties. ”
Moss also said that he and partners Steve Stahlschmidt and Dave Hemsath are going to Kansas City for the NHRA Division 5 track owners meeting on Jan. 20 and 21. Moss said, “We will also have people taking track safety courses and getting more people SFI certified as inspectors. We are also still purchasing stuff for the track and getting more things ready so there is less we have to do after construction is complete. We are still gathering materials which will either be delivered to the property or to our secured location.”
